    U.S. Soldiers assigned to the 173rd Mobile Brigade Combat Team (Airborne) showcase unmanned aerial systems and emerging technology during the African Lion 26 defense-in-depth lane at Cap Draa, Tan-Tan, Morocco, May 2, 2026. The DiD lane apart of the command field exercise tested the unit’s ability to synchronize robotic platforms, smart sensors, remote obstacle systems, and counter-unmanned aerial system capabilities within a layered, echelon defense, deliberately stressing command and control to validate new multi-layered defensive techniques.

    AL26 is U.S. Africa Command’s largest annual joint exercise, designed to strengthen collective security capabilities of the U.S., African nations and global allies. Led by U.S. Army Southern European Task Force, Africa (SETAF-AF) from April 20 to May 8 2026, and hosted in Ghana, Morocco, Senegal and Tunisia, AL26 involves over 5,600 personnel from more than 40 nations, using innovation to drive partner-led regional security.
